What should the nurse instruct a male client with sexual dysfunction?
 
  1. Wear briefs rather than boxers for scrotal support.
  2. Depression and anxiety make sexual dysfunction difficult to treat.
  3. Decrease the use of over-the-counter medications, including n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s).
  4. Stop smoking and limit alcohol use.

Answer to Question 1

Correct Answer: 4
Rationale 1: This treatment is not indicated for sexual dysfunction.
Rationale 2: Anxiety and depression are medically treatable conditions.
Rationale 3: The use of NSAIDs does not have an effect on male sexual dysfunction.
Rationale 4: Cigarette smoking and alcohol use are strongly associated with erectile dysfunction.
Global Rationale: Cigarette smoking and alcohol use are strongly associated with erectile dysfunction. ED is not associated with choice of clothing. Anxiety and depression are medically treatable conditions. The use of NSAIDs is not associated with male sexual dysfunction.

The average person is easily confused by the terms pharmaceutics and pharmacology, thinking they are one and the same. Whereas pharmaceutics is the science of preparing and dispensing drugs (otherwise known as the science of pharmacy), pharmacology is the study of medications.
